United States
(The U.S. has produced the most legendary players due to the NBA's dominance.)
Early Era (Pre-1980s)
1. George Mikan (1940s–50s) – First true NBA superstar, 5× NBA champion.
2. Bill Russell (1950s–60s) – 11× NBA champion (most in history), defensive legend.
3. Wilt Chamberlain (1960s–70s) – 100-point game, 4× MVP, 2× NBA champion.
4. Oscar Robertson (1960s–70s) – First player to average a triple-double for a season.
5. Jerry West (1960s–70s) – NBA logo silhouette, 1× NBA champion, 14× All-Star.
Magic vs. Bird Era (1980s)
6. Magic Johnson 5× NBA champion, 3× MVP, greatest point guard ever.
7. Larry Bird – 3× NBA champion, 3× MVP, one of the best shooters ever.
8. Kareem Abdul-Jabbar – NBA’s all-time leading scorer (38,387 pts), 6× MVP.
9. Julius "Dr. J" Erving – ABA/NBA legend, revolutionized dunking.
Michael Jordan Era (1990s)
10. Michael Jordan – 6× NBA champion, 6× Finals MVP, widely considered the GOAT.
11. Hakeem Olajuwon – 2× NBA champion (back-to-back), best footwork for a big man.
12. Karl Malone & John Stockton – Legendary Jazz duo (all-time leading scorer & assist leader).
13. Charles Barkley – MVP, dominant undersized power forward.
Kobe/Shaq/Duncan Era (2000s)
14. Kobe Bryant – 5× NBA champion, 2× Finals MVP, "Mamba Mentality."
15. Shaquille O’Neal – 4× NBA champion, most dominant physical force in NBA history.
16. Tim Duncan – 5× NBA champion, best power forward ever.
17. Allen Iverson – MVP, cultural icon, greatest small scorer ever.
LeBron/Curry/Durant Era (2010s–Present)
18. LeBron James – 4× NBA champion, all-time leading scorer, longevity king.
19. Stephen Curry – 4× NBA champion, greatest shooter ever, revolutionized the game.
20. Kevin Durant – 2× NBA champion, elite scorer, 1× MVP.
21. Kawhi Leonard – 2× NBA champion, elite two-way player.
International Legends (By Country)
Serbia / Yugoslavia
22. Vlade Divac (1980s–2000s) – Pioneering European big man in the NBA.
23. Peja Stojaković (2000s) – Elite shooter, NBA champion (2011).
24. Nikola Jokić (2010s–present) – 2× MVP, 1× NBA champion, best-passing big man ever.
Croatia
25. Draen Petrović (1980s–90s) One of Europes greatest shooters, NBA All-Star.
26. Toni Kukoč (1990s) 3x NBA champion, EuroLeague legend.
Germany
27. Dirk Nowitzki (2000s-2010s), 2011 NBA champion, MVP, best European scorer.
Greece
28. Giannis Antetokounmpo (2010s-present), 2x MVP, 1× NBA champion, "Greek Freak."
Spain
29. Pau Gasol (2000s–2010s) – 2× NBA champion, best Spanish player ever.
30. Marc Gasol (2010s) – NBA champion (2019), Defensive Player of the Year.
France
31. Tony Parker (2000s–2010s) – 4× NBA champion, Finals MVP (2007).
32. Rudy Gobert (2010s–present) – 3× Defensive Player of the Year.
Lithuania
33. Arvydas Sabonis (1980s–2000s) – Dominant in Europe, NBA pioneer.
34. Domantas Sabonis (2010s–present) – All-Star, son of Arvydas.
Slovenia
35. Luka Dončić (2010s–present) – Multiple-time All-NBA, future MVP candidate.
Canada
36. Steve Nash (1990s–2010s) – 2× MVP, best Canadian player ever.
37. Andrew Wiggins (2010s–present) – NBA champion (2022).
Argentina
38. Manu Ginóbili (2000s–2010s) – 4× NBA champion, Olympic gold (2004).
China
39. Yao Ming (2000s) – 8× NBA All-Star, global ambassador for basketball.
Nigeria
40. Hakeem Olajuwon (Naturalized U.S., born in Nigeria)
